Lakeland is aptly named for its abundance of beautiful lakes. With a total of 38 named lakes within city limits, as well as numerous smaller bodies of water, Lakeland offers a wealth of opportunities for water-based recreation and relaxation. Whether you’re a fan of swimming, boating, fishing, or simply enjoying the view, Lakeland’s lakes offer something for everyone. They are a valuable natural resource and a key part of what makes Lakeland such a wonderful place to live

Lakeland Florida | Top 10 F.A.Q.

What is the cost of living in Lakeland?

The cost of living in Lakeland is generally lower than the state and national average, making it an affordable place to live.

Is Lakeland a good place to retire?

Yes, Lakeland is often rated as one of the best places to retire in Florida due to its affordable cost of living, warm weather, and recreational opportunities.

What types of housing options are available in Lakeland?

Lakeland offers a variety of housing options, from condos and apartments to single-family homes, farms and ranches and luxury properties.

What is the quality of schools in Lakeland?

Lakeland is served by Polk County Public Schools, which offers a variety of high-quality educational options, including traditional, magnet, and charter schools.

What's the Average Cost of a House in Lakeland, FL?

According to various sources on the internet, in October 2023 the median listing home price in Lakeland, FL was between $292,407 and $350,000

What is the crime rate in Lakeland?

Like any city, crime rates vary by neighborhood. Overall, Lakeland’s crime rate is on par with the national average.

How is the traffic in Lakeland?

While Lakeland generally has less traffic than larger cities, congestion can occur during peak hours – especially on interstate 4 (i4), US 98 near the I4 intersection and on South Florida Avenue.
